Transaction deb90e3a34c05749bff5782dbe3d9a9629aaecc7dc2082d06e0b34d3cdbc3756
1 Input
1 Output
-
deb90e3a34c05749bff5782dbe3d9a9629aaecc7dc2082d06e0b34d3cdbc3756:0
- value
- 166547
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 602de72ca405c96b4936b2d607169666fd4dbbe7 OP_EQUAL
- address
- 3ATZnMh5hkENuxj7xdudLQFHcjsqCAXrLx